The Employment of Ukrainians as an Opportunity to Fill the Labour Market in Poland – Selected Issues

The Employment of Ukrainians as an Opportunity to Fill the Labour Market in Poland – Selected Issues

Author(s): Krystyna Gomółka,Małgorzata Gawrycka,Marta Kuc-Czarnecka / Language(s): English Issue: 2/2023

The labour market in Poland has undergone significant transformations over the past two decades. The observed changes have been influenced by various factors related to, among other things, the possibility of free movement of the population resulting from membership of EU structures, demographic changes, technological changes, and the automation and robotisation of production processes. Demographic change is becoming a significant challenge, highlighting the shortage of workers with different qualifications and competencies in the labour market in various sectors of the national economy. This paper aims to indicate to what extent Ukrainian citizens can fill the gaps in Poland’s emerging labour market. To that end, a survey was conducted in the Qualtrics programme in May-June 2022 among Ukrainian citizens who arrived in Poland before 24th February 2022, i.e., before the outbreak of the war and who were registered in the Gremi Personal database. This particular company provides support connected to employment for Ukrainians. Due to the non-probabilistic sampling technique, the results cannot be generalised with regard to the entire population. To analyse the results, descriptive statistics were used to examine the population structure and determine the signifi cance of the characteristics studied and the correlation between them. The research shows that labour shortages in Poland’s labour market can be compensated to some extent by employing migrants from, for example, Ukraine. The commencement of the proper research was preceded by the preparation of a pilot study and the collection and analysis of statistical data related to the situation on the Polish labour market, taking into account the level and structure of employment and an indication of shortages in the labour market when the research was prepared, and the fact that complete statistical data ended in 2020, hence the decision to include this research period in the analyses.

Effects of media on cryptocurrencies prices

Effects of media on cryptocurrencies prices

Author(s): Ana Todorovska,Hristijan Peshov,Eva Spirovska,Ivan Rusevski,Irena Vodenska,Lubomir Chitkushev,Dimitar Trajanov / Language(s): English Issue: 1/2021

Cryptocurrencies present a novel medium of exchange that enables secure financial transactions without a central clearing authority. Billions of dollars are traded on the cryptocurrency market, contributing to the increased importance of cryptocurrencies within the global financial system. The cryptocurrency market is highly volatile and influenced by different social media and other media outlets. This study aims to investigate media influence, assessing the degree and nature of influence. We analyze historical cryptocurrency prices and utilize an NLP model to extract sentiments from the data obtained by social media and other media outlets. We use Time Series Forecasting and Explainable AI models to depict best the influence of media outlets over the cryptocurrency market. We compare the results for the different social media and other media outlets and present the findings that can be used in future research and cryptocurrency price forecasting.

Challenges, Requirements, Opportunities and Solutions for the Digital Transformation of the Transport Education
4.50 €
Preview

Challenges, Requirements, Opportunities and Solutions for the Digital Transformation of the Transport Education

Author(s): Georgi Hristov,Ivan Beloev,Plamen Zahariev / Language(s): English Issue: 4s/2023

The digital transformation impacted many aspects of the everyday human live. This global phenomenon changed almost all industries and has led to improved working efficiency, overall enhancements of many activities and processes and the establishment of many new professions. The transition into the digital era was fuelled by the vast development, the wide acceptance and the increased use of many new technologies, devices and solutions. Nevertheless, the digital transformation has also resulted in new challenges and has defined new difficulties, which have to be addressed. The transport sector was no exception to the transformation processes and was also significantly impacted by them. Many new technologies for monitoring, control and optimization of the aerial, land and water traffic have been developed and are currently widely used. The paradigms and the leading technologies of the digital transformation, like Big Data, Internet of Things, 5G mobile connectivity, Artificial Intelligence, Information systems and many others have been adapted and integrated in the different transport-related processes and activities. While this transformation resulted in increased income, better traffic management, safer and faster transportation services and reduced workloads for the involved staff, it has also put the transport education sector into a difficult and challenging position – the present-day digital transportation technologies demand the transformation of many traditional educational courses into multidisciplinary IT-oriented subjects. In its own turn, the integration of these new courses requires the purchase and use of specialized equipment and devices, the constant adaptation and improvement of the educational materials and the regular requalification of the teaching staff. In this article, we present and investigate some of the challenges, requirements, opportunities and solutions for the transition of the education in transport into the digital age. The various modern IT-related technologies and solutions in the transport sector are presented, analysed and discussed in details in the manuscript. Last, but not least, we have summarized and discussed the present challenges and requirements for the education processes in the area of the transport education.

Изкуственият интелект в звукорежисурата
4.50 €
Preview

Изкуственият интелект в звукорежисурата

Author(s): Pavel Stefanov / Language(s): Bulgarian Issue: 4s/2023

Artificial intelligence is more and more present into all areas of human activity. Art, and music in particular, is no exception to this trend. In the field of sound engineering, there are numerous activities where AI can assist the human sound engineer with great success. For some sound engineering tasks, AI applications are very useful and have great practical positives. In sound processing, analysis and decomposition of a stereophonic mix into its component parts, AI has had considerable success. Cleaning up certain elements of the phonogram is also an area of enviable achievement for AI applications. In a process such as music mastering, AI is again doing quite well (though not perfectly) insofar as its functions consist of application of detailed analytical operations, established algorithms, extrapolation, and synthesis. In more complex tasks such as mixing, for example, where different approaches make the possible variations immeasurably more numerous, AI still has relatively modest success.

Създаване на интерактивни видеоуроци за преподаване и оценяване знанията на студентите с Edpuzzle
4.50 €
Preview

Създаване на интерактивни видеоуроци за преподаване и оценяване знанията на студентите с Edpuzzle

Author(s): Ivelina Petrova / Language(s): Bulgarian Issue: 4s/2023

The pandemic was of great help in modernizing the classroom. Back to face-to-face classes, the same internet tools used during the emergency remote teaching can still be employed by teachers as students want to learn “in their way” – using the mobile inside the class and having control over their learning. Online video platforms are popular because of their advantages. However, watching a video may be a passive experience and teachers need to customize the video in order to engage their students and teach more effectively. Edpuzzle is one of the free online tools that has turned out to be a game changer. It makes creating and editing educational videos easy and saves class time for higher level matters. Moreover, this tool is good for formative assessment and feedback. The advantage for students is that it allows them to work on the assignment at their own pace and, at the same time, it holds them accountable. Besides, the multiple attempts feature lets them improve their results.My class experience confirmed research results that Edpuzzle could be part of the teacher-training program.

Zwroty niedookreślone w dyrektywie UE 2019/1937 w sprawie ochrony osób zgłaszających naruszenia prawa Unii oraz jej wpływ na ochronę środowiska (wybrane zagadnienia)

Zwroty niedookreślone w dyrektywie UE 2019/1937 w sprawie ochrony osób zgłaszających naruszenia prawa Unii oraz jej wpływ na ochronę środowiska (wybrane zagadnienia)

Author(s): Artur Żurawik / Language(s): Polish Issue: 1/2023

Directive 2019/1937 of the European Parliament and of the Council of October 23, 2019 on the protection of persons reporting breaches of EU law poses new challenges for the Member States of the European Union. This act has a real impact not only on the situation and functioning of various public bodies and institutions, but also on entrepreneurs. At the same time, it covers a wide range of applications. One of such areas is environmental protection. At the same time, the directive uses many underspecified phrases, undoubtedly very interesting from the point of view of their interpretation, including those which names are known to EU and national legislation, but gives them a different meaning. It should be reconstructed separately for the purposes of applying this particular legal act and the implementing provisions. It is also not possible to automatically transfer the case law or doctrinal views developed on the basis of the existing practice for the purposes of applying the provisions on the protection of persons reporting breaches of EU law.

DRUŠTVENI KONTEKST FUDBALA KROZ ISTORIJSKI, POLITIČKI, EKONOMSKI I MEDIJSKI OKVIR

DRUŠTVENI KONTEKST FUDBALA KROZ ISTORIJSKI, POLITIČKI, EKONOMSKI I MEDIJSKI OKVIR

Author(s): Predrag Đ. Bajić / Language(s): Serbian Issue: 1/2023

As a very dynamic social phenomenon, sport plays a significant role in everyday life. This applies especially to football, as the most influential sport globally. Authors Dejan Milenković and Vesna Milenković decided to look at this phenomenon from several angles and systematize it through the book "Football and Society". After a historical overview, the authors look at football through its relations with politics, economics and the media, with special reference to the changes that have occurred as a result of the Covid-19 pandemic. Also, the book contains chapters about women's football, as well as about football and violence (sections about hooliganism, terrorism, hate speech and racism). In the end, the authors conclude that football, like society, has repeatedly found itself at a historical turning point and that it is still happening today. However, they emphasize that football always manages to overcome all challenges and increase its popularity and social influence.
